Sweeney Foundation is a charitable organization based in West Vancouver, British Columbia, classified by the CRA under support of schools and education. In its fiscal year ending June 30, 2024, it reported $83K in revenue and $51K in expenditures.
Compared with 3,624 education charities of similar size, its share of spending on mission — charitable programs plus grants to other charities — ranked above 28% of peers.
Its filed list of directors and trustees shows 4 names.
In its own words
To advance education by providing publicly available scholarships bursaries and other forms of financial assistance to women in financial need to be used for post secondary education. The foundation was active for programs board development activities workshops strategic planning and operational methods.
